Pertamina close to seal 2nd LNG import deal
Wednesday, July 2 2014 - 12:53 AM WIB
State oil, gas company PT Pertamina (Persero) said it was close to seal deal to import LNG from Africa starting 2020, according to a company official.
?We are currently finalizing the deal,? Didik Sasongko, Pertamina?s VP for LNG Marketing told Petromindo.Com on Tuesday without disclosing the supplier?s name.
He added that the African LNG supplier will supply 1 million tonnes per annum to Pertamina under long-term contract.
Didik said that Pertamina is seeking to import up to 3.6MTPA of LNG starting 2020.
Thus far, the company has signed deal to take LNG from Cheniere Energy Inc. (LNG)?s project in Corpus Christi, Texas. Under the deal Pertamina will buy 1.52 MTPA of LNG starting 2018 for Indonesia?s domestic market.
